Jinan layover

Hi,
We are holding Singaporea Passports, and will be travelling to South Korea via Shandong airlines.
Singapore (SIN) → Jinan (TNA) → South Korea (ICN), with a 11-hour layover in Jinan.

Please correct me if I'm wrong:
Upon arriving at Jinan Airport, we need to apply for the Temporary Entry Permit on the spot. Once granted, we can exit the airport, then return in time to catch the connecting flight to South Korea.

Repeat the above steps for the return leg.

Question - do we still need to fill up the online arrival card through Chinese National Immigration Administration website even though we will be applying for the temporary entry permit on the spot?

Lim, I would like to inform you that the citizens of Singapore do not need 24 or 240 hour visa free transit schemes because they can enter mainland China absolutely visa free for up to 30 days. Simply speaking 24 or 240 hour visa free transit are irrelevant for the citizens of Singapore and consequently, you do not need them. Also, you should not bother yourself about the flight route because you can travel to China from Singapore and return to Singapore directly, if you want.

So, the answer to your question is, you will need to fill out arrival card and I recommend you to do it online through Chinese National Immigration administration (NIA) website ahead of your travel. It will be much easier to fulfill the immigration requirements if you do that. Just forget about temporary entry permits, you do not need them. Basically, you should not bother yourself with any additional detail because this will be quite straightforward for you. I hope this helps.

In other words, when we arrive at Jinan airport, we will join the regular immigration line for foreigners to exit the Airport?

Is it possible for us Not to collect our checked-in baggage when exiting Jinan airport? As in, can we only collect it when we arrive in South Korea?

Lim, you are correct in your assumption that you will queue at the regular immigration line for foreigners. You are encouraged to fill out your arrival card online, ahead of your departure toward mainland China and upon landing and before the immigration line you will just perform fingerprinting at the self-service (automatic) fingerprinting machine.

As far as your baggage is concerned this is something that is related to the airline and airport policies, but the huge chance is that your baggage will be tagged all the way to South Korea. In any case, you will know about that detail at the moment of your check-in in Singapore. If the baggage is not tagged all the way to South Korea, you will collect it in Jinan and deposit at Jinan airport left baggage facility. I hope this helps.
